Indiana’s Cool North in Full Bloom
Posted on May 10, 2025 by Dina Miller
Spring and summer in Indiana’s Cool North bring vibrant gardens and colorful blooms to life. From tulips and daffodils in early spring to roses, coneflowers, and lilies in full summer, the region bursts with natural beauty. Botanical gardens, wildflower trails, and community parks offer serene escapes. Garden centers and farm markets overflow with fresh flowers, plants, and local produce, making it easy to bring the season home. Festivals and floral displays celebrate nature’s charm across this northern Indiana haven.
Freckle Farm: Where Old Becomes New Again
Freckle Farm Primitives & Antiques, LaPorte, is a warm, rustic boutique offering primitive farmhouse furniture, vintage décor, architectural salvage, and handcrafted goods. Owner Krystal curates affordable treasures like harvest tables and jadeite pieces that rotate weekly. Friendly, inviting atmosphere with one‑of‑a‑kind finds that feel like home.
